Department-wise allocation in Gujarat Budget 2023-24

Gandhinagar: Gujarat finance minister Kanubhai Desai today presented the state budget of Rs 3.01 lakh crore for fiscal 2023-24. The finance minister made the biggest allocation in the Education sector of Rs 43,651 crore, followed by the Agriculture, Farmer’s Welfare and Co-operation Department getting Rs. 21,605 crore. Rs 15,182 crore were allocated for the health sector. Rs 18,000 crore for Ahmedabad Metro Phase-II under Urban Development and Urban Housing Department

Department-wise allocation in Gujarat Budget 2023-24 2023-24 (₹ in Crore) 2022-23 (₹ in Crore)
1 Education Department 43651 34,884
2 Agriculture, Farmer’s Welfare and Co-operation Department 21605 7,737
3 Roads and Buildings Department 20642 12,024
4 Urban Development and Urban Housing Department 19685 14,297
5 Health and Family Welfare Department 15182 12,240
6 Rural Housing and Rural Development Department 10743 9,048
7 Water Resource Division 9705 5,339
8 Energy and Petrochemicals Department 8738 15,568
9 Industries and Mines Department 8589 7,030
10 Home Department 8574 8,325
11 Women and Child Development 6064 4,976
12 Water Supply Division 6000 5,451
13 Social Justice and Empowerment Department 5580 4,782
14 Revenue Department 5140 4,394
15 Ports and Transport Department 3514 1,504
16 Tribal Development Department 3410 2,909
17 Labour, Skill Development and Employment Department 2538 1,837
18 Science and Technology Department 2193 670
19 Food, Civil Supplies and Consumer Affairs Department 2165 1,526
20 Forest and Environment Department 2063 1,822
21 Legal Department 2014 1,740
22 General Administrative Department 1980 2,146
23 Climate Change Department 937 931
24 Sports, Youth and Cultural Activities Department 568 517
25 Information and Broadcasting Department 257 199
